Subgroup Analyses in Stepped-Wedge Cluster Randomized Trials: A Systematic Review of Statistical Practice and

Objective:
Subgroup analyses can inform whether intervention effects differ systematically across participants, but they are prone to false-positive findings, low power, and selective reporting. Stepped-wedge cluster randomized trials (SW-CRTs) introduce additional inferential complexities (e.g., time effects, clustering, complex interactions) yet subgroup-analysis practice in SW-CRTs has not been systematically evaluated. Our objectives were to describe: (1) the prevalence and extent of subgroup analyses; (2) characteristics of the subgroup variables of interest; (3) adherence to key recommendations such as pre-specification and justification; (4) statistical approaches used; and (5) details of reporting results.
Study Design And Setting:
We reviewed primary reports of completed health-related SW-CRTs from a 2016-2023 database to capture statistical and reporting practice. Trials were eligible if they had at least two sequences, three periods, and randomized at least 5 clusters. Two independent reviewers extracted information from each trial and reached consensus through discussion. Results were summarized using median (interquartile ranges) and frequencies (%).
Results:
Of 211 eligible reports, 99 (47%) presented results of at least one subgroup analysis; the median number of subgroup analyses (unique outcome by covariate combinations) per trial was 4 (Q1-Q3:2-8; range:1-81). Only 23 (23%) clearly prespecified all presented subgroup analyses. A rationale for all subgroup analyses was provided in 28 (28%), while 53 (54%) provided none. Stratified analyses were common (n=79, 80%); the use of interaction testing was reported in 49 (50%), but only 35 (35%) reported an interaction test result with the treatment indicator. Power calculations for subgroup analyses were rare (n=4, 4%), and multiplicity corrections were uncommon (n=2, 2%). At least one statistically significant stratum-specific treatment effect was observed in 69 (70%) trials.
Conclusions:
Subgroup analyses are common in SW-CRTs but are frequently under-specified and inconsistently analyzed and reported, with limited interaction testing, minimal power justification, and rare adjustment for multiple testing. These patterns are broadly consistent with concerns identified in prior subgroup-analysis reviews of randomized trials, suggesting that longstanding vulnerabilities persist in SW-CRTs and may be compounded by design complexity. More explicit, design-aware guidance for planning, analysis, and reporting of subgroup investigations in SW-CRTs may improve the credibility and interpretability of subgroup findings.
